    nomaphila siamensis dwarf

    A smaller version of the Hygrophila corymbosa. Beautiful bushy midground cover plant which can vary from dark brown to dark green with silver/purple colours underneath. It can grow up to 15cm in height but usually stays below 10cm. Propagate from cuttings. Place of originSouth East Asia...
